Centennial Crab Scionwood
A cross of Wealthy and Dolgo Crab. A yellow crab apple with white, crisp, and juicy flesh. The flavor is sweet and nutty. Apples get to be 1.5 - 2 inches in diameter. Great pollinator.

Chenango Strawberry Scionwood
A medium to large apple with yellow/greenish skin with some red stripping. A dessert apple that is good for lots of uses. The white flesh is firm, juicy and very aromatic. Trees are hardy but susceptible to fire blight.

Cherry Cox Scionwood
Sport of Cox Orange Pippin from Denmark. Often shows dark red stripes and splashes of the solid red fruit. Keeps in storage one month longer than others of this type.

Chestnut Crab Scionwood
A large crab that is good for cooking and desserts. The flesh is crisp, juicy and sweet and has a nut-like flavor. A very hardy tree and resistant to cedar-apple rust.

Bringing back Heirloom Fruit
We are in the business of providing scionwood and acclimatized varieties of apple trees, pear trees, and plum trees. We specialize in antique apples which are propagated at our nursery in Northeastern Wisconsin. Our hundreds of varieties of antique apple trees include Ashmeads's Kernel, Calville Blanc d'Hiver, Cox Orange Pippin, Esopus Spitzenburg, Hudson's Golden Gem, Pitmaston Pineapple, Roxbury Russet, and Pink Pearl to name a few. For those who do their own grafting, we sell scionwood of most of our antique apple tree varieties. We will also do custom bench grafting of any of our cultivars on our standard, semi-dwarfing and dwarfing rootstock. Shipping is available for all of our products.
